Police seek public assistance in theft investigation.

25-34915

The Kingston Police are investigating an incident of theft from a cash register at a local restaurant.

On September 26, 2025, at approximately 2:46 a.m. two suspects entered the restaurant located in the area of Bath Road and Portsmouth Avenue. The suspects then stole a quantity of currency from a cash register located inside the restaurant.

The suspects are described as a Caucasian male between 35 and 40 years of age, wearing a backwards red ‘Blue Jays’ hat, a grey ‘Messi’ hoodie, blue jeans and black shoes. 

The first suspect was accompanied by another Caucasian male who appeared to be between 50 and 60 years of age, with a full white, well-groomed beard, black ball hat, black shirt and black pants. The second suspect also appeared to be wearing boots.
